Output 852ca8933a2e618350865297bfce50c3e6d6fc54ff50b827a06aa542d6b7bb52:0

value
28611192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71e33291a41f72e6b975ca08dfc57350faf7f158 OP_EQUAL
address
3C5CTBWgzHoJq4N8TydMu3RSeywd3EJQwu
transaction
852ca8933a2e618350865297bfce50c3e6d6fc54ff50b827a06aa542d6b7bb52
confirmations
289793
spent
true